Kristen Perry (she/they)

Operations Director

Kristen is an Arts and Healthcare professional. A graduate of The University of Florida's Arts in Medicine masters degree program, Kristen strives to pair her experience as a life-long theatre fanatic, technician, and stage manager with nonprofit programming and development know-how to create vibrant spaces where artistic healing can thrive.

In addition to her work with SheWolf, Kristen is a founding member of Girls Rock Camp St. Pete, a grassroots movement that uses music as a medium to promote self-confidence, creativity, and a strong sense of community among girls and gender non-conforming youth in St. Petersburg, Florida. Her love of music has also given her over a decade of experience managing concerts and festivals of all styles and sizes, including Gainesville-based The Fest. Kristen relocated to the Chicago are in 2017 and is excited to continue growing her wolf pack here.

Vanessa De Leon (she/her)

Development Director

Vanessa De Leon is a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or, Registered Dance Movement Therapist, Life Coach, and Registered Yoga Teacher with a Master's Degree in Clinical Psychology. She also possesses a clinical history of working with people with developmental disabilities, children with autism spectrum disorders, and adults with Posttraumatic Stress Disorder, sexual trauma, severe mental illnesses, chronic homelessness, eating disorders, and other mental health symptoms.

Throughout all of her clinical experiences, Vanessa had always empowered the people she worked with through a model of survivorship rather than prey victim to circumstance. Through a strengths-based approach with an emphasis on the body-mind connection and the power of community, Vanessa firmly believes that healing is not only generated but sustained for a long period of time.
